Senate Committee Inquiry

On September 25, 2008, Senator Scott Ludlam asked the Selection of Bills Committee to refer the National Rental Affordability Scheme Bill 2008 and National Rental Affordability Scheme (Consequential Amendments) Bill 2008 to the Community Affairs Committee. His reasons for referring the Bills to Committee are to investigate: whether the Bills are targeted to deliver affordable housing to those in greatest needwhether the Bills are an efficient and effective way to deliver increased affordable housingwhether the Bills facilitate investment in social housing by not for profit community housing organisations as well as private investors. The Committee has called for submissions which close on October 24.
